Germany very optimistic on Poland-Russia meat deal
19 Jan 2007 13:16:31 GMT
Source: Reuters
BERLIN, Jan 19 (Reuters) - German Foreign Minister Frank-Walter Steinmeier told reporters on Friday he was "very optimistic" about a deal that would end a Russian import ban on Polish meat.

As European Union President, Germany is trying to help hammer out an agreement to end the year-old Russian ban which is holding up the start of talks on a broad cooperation agreement between the EU and Russia.

Steinmeier also said he had "good hope" those talks could start soon.
